Se protéger des trackers sur les plateformes mobiles

Suivi en ligne



De nombreux utilisateurs sont quotidiennement confrontés au suivi sur Internet. L'une des conséquences les plus évidentes et les plus importantes est la publicité ciblée. Quiconque a déjà traité avec des géants tels que, par exemple, Google AdWords, sait à quel point les paramètres du public cible sont disponibles pour l'annonceur.





, . .





- -. , : , , . , .





— .





(disconnectme). , .



(Pi-hole ), Android iOS.



Android



– IP- iptables. – root- , Android . root.



. . VpnService VPN, . : -, --tcp, --udp. / . TcpIn, TcpOut, UdpIn, UdpOut , . Github (LocalVPN).



iOS



NetworkExtension.

Android, . NEFilterControlProvider NEFilterDataProvider. , Content Filter Providers (supervised) , - AppStore . Github (sift-ios, FilterControlProvider, FilterDataProvider).



VPN. NetworkExtension VPN.



Personal VPN. . , .



App Proxy Provider. VPN . , .

Packet Tunnel Provider. VPN . .



NEPacketTunnelProvider. – , , , GCDHTTPProxyServer, . . NEPacketTunnelProvider GCDHTTPProxyServer Github (lockdown-ios PacketTunnelProvider).



, VPN



VPN, . – ( VPN) . . ( ). , .





Aujourd'hui, nous avons examiné les moyens de mettre en œuvre des filtres de trafic pour Android et iOS. Nous avons considéré la méthode la plus non limitative - un VPN local et les bases de sa mise en œuvre avec des exemples de produits finis et des exemples. Pour ce faire, nous avons profité de la possibilité de créer des protocoles VPN personnalisés. Avec leur aide, nous avons eu accès à la couche réseau depuis la couche application, ce qui nous a permis d'appliquer un filtre aux paquets entrants / sortants. Nous basons notre filtre sur les listes noires de domaines de suivi disponibles sur Internet.



L'article a été préparé pour la chaîne Telegram @paradiSEcurity .




All Articles